This modification on the molecules will direct them to elution. Besides the Trade of ions, ion-Trade stationary phases will be able to keep distinct neutral molecules. This process is relevant to the retention determined by the development of complexes, and particular ions like transition metals could be retained with a cation-exchange resin and might however settle for lone-pair electrons from donor ligands. Therefore neutral ligand molecules may be retained on resins handled While using the transitional steel ions.

The most popular HPLC detectors take advantage of an analyte’s UV/Vis absorption spectrum. These detectors vary from basic patterns, where the analytical wavelength is selected using appropriate filters, to the modified spectrophotometer during which the sample compartment includes a move mobile.

During the ionization chamber the remaining molecules—a check here mix of the cellular phase components and solutes—endure ionization and fragmentation. The mass spectrometer’s mass analyzer separates the ions website by their mass-to-demand ratio (m/z). A detector counts the ions and shows the mass spectrum.
